We're thinking of using Remote Desktop/Assistance for some in-house
usability testing.

We want it to operate in two modes: when we're watching and also when not.

Remote Desktop is attractive to us, because we want them to log on like
normal and work with the desktop, but we don't want to have to grant them
permission to use the system ala R.A., or have R.A.'s extra windows open the
whole time.

But is there a way to allow us to view the remote desktop as they are using
it?

For this, you should get realvnc from http://www.realvnc.com It's like
Remote Desktop, but you do not need to log the current user off. You must
install a new server to use this. Download is about 1 meg.
